It is not Anwar, it is whoever playing the role of Anwar – TK Chua



With Datuk Seri Anwar Ibrahim’s conviction, many have started talking about his successor.  Yes, charisma and leadership do play a part.  But ultimately, the focus should be on the political and democratic process of this country.
This is my take: we can replace Anwar a hundred times, but as long as someone is playing the role of Anwar, that person will not be free from predicaments.
Whoever is playing the role of Anwar will have his life turned upside-down, that is for sure.  
He will be criticised for dividing Malaysians and perhaps being a traitor to his race and religion.
His personal life will be monitored and examined to the fullest details.
His personal finance will be subjected to endless insinuation and allegation.
So don’t just replace Anwar with another leader. We have to re-examine the whole political and democratic process.
With Anwar now in jail, other leaders wanting to step into his shoes must critically examine themselves first and foremost.
Firstly, they must have an impeccable credential and character, free from blemishes. 
Second, they must have the tenacity to stay for the long haul.
Third, they must find new ways to struggle within our political and democratic system.
It is useless to do the same thing over and over again and expect different results. 
Right now most Pakatan Rakyat leaders are not even united in their resolve, much less their ability to think outside the box.
And for us the people, I think we must appreciate that it is never easy to be opposition politicians, more so to be the leader.
